Orificemeter is a device that is used to measure the flow rate of a fluid in a pipe. It works on the principle of Bernoulli's equation which states that the pressure of a fluid decreases as the velocity of the fluid increases.
The orificemeter is installed in a pipe and it consists of a flat plate with a hole in the center. The size of the hole is known as the orificemeter diameter. The orificemeter diameter is related to the pipe diameter in the following way:
